Output f8ee3bb91157f9d69393edd2bef0df655eb4840c24a53e0bd6739a702c254b09:3

value
41932502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80fba49ae3eff84e37f713192e5fd7e4a1e12d87 OP_EQUAL
address
3DT1sZQ6mukV45Jd8bytaTr3RQAHmdigGS
transaction
f8ee3bb91157f9d69393edd2bef0df655eb4840c24a53e0bd6739a702c254b09
spent
true